Kids Spidy Font for Business Branding

As a small business owner, I’ve learned that even the smallest design choices can have a big impact on how customers perceive your brand. When I was redesigning my bakery’s packaging, I knew I needed a font that could stand out while still feeling professional. That’s when I discovered Kids Spidy—a thick and versatile display font that brought exactly the right energy to my brand.

Kids Spidy for Bakery Packaging and Product Labels

Kids Spidy is perfect for bakery packaging and product labels because it adds a bold, eye-catching presence without overwhelming the design. Its thick strokes make it instantly readable, even on small labels or printed materials. For my bakery boxes, I used Kids Spidy for the product names and special offers, which helped create a cohesive look across all my packaging. The font’s personality feels playful yet polished, making it ideal for businesses that want to feel approachable but professional.

When choosing a display font like Kids Spidy, it’s important to consider how it will work in different sizes and formats. On a small label, the font remains legible, and on larger banners, it commands attention. This versatility makes it a great choice for any business looking to build a strong visual identity.

Kids Spidy for Café Menus and Online Shop Banners

Updating my café’s menu was another opportunity to test out Kids Spidy. I used it for the headings and special sections, giving the menu a fresh, modern look. The font’s thick lines and clean structure made it easy to read from a distance, which is essential for printed menus. It also worked well with my existing color scheme, adding a touch of creativity without clashing.

For online shop banners, Kids Spidy added a dynamic edge. Whether I was promoting seasonal items or new products, the font helped draw attention and reinforce my brand’s personality. It paired well with a simple sans serif for body text, creating a balanced and professional look that felt both modern and inviting.

Kids Spidy for Brand Identity and Logo Design

One of the most exciting uses of Kids Spidy was in logo design. I experimented with using it as a standalone logo, and it held up surprisingly well. Its boldness made it memorable, and its versatility allowed it to work in different color schemes and backgrounds. It wasn’t the best choice for long, detailed text, but for short phrases and headlines, it was spot-on.

When pairing Kids Spidy with other fonts, I found that it worked best with clean, minimal styles. A simple sans serif for body text or an elegant serif for a more refined look helped balance the font’s boldness. This made it easier to use across different brand assets, from website headers to printed brochures.
